肝脏疾病因其病理机制和有限的临床治疗策略,已成为全球性的健康挑战。黄芩Scutellaria baicalensis作为传统中药,具有清热燥湿、泻火解毒、止血安胎之功效,其现代药理学研究表明其具有抗菌、抗病毒、抗炎、解热、保肝利胆等多种药理活性。越来越多的研究表明,黄芩及其活性成分、复方在病毒性肝炎、代谢相关脂肪性肝病(MAFLD)、肝纤维化及肝癌等肝脏疾病中展现出显著疗效。以“黄芩”“活性成分”“肝脏疾病”“作用机制”为关键词,系统检索了中国学术期刊全文数据库(CNKI)、Pubmed等数据库中黄芩及其活性成分、复方在肝脏疾病中的相关研究。综述黄芩主要活性成分及其复方调控肝脏疾病的关键作用机制,包括抗炎、抗氧化、调控细胞自噬与凋亡、抑制肝星状细胞活化及调节肠道菌群等途径,以期为阐明其药理作用提供科学依据,并为肝脏疾病的临床治疗与新药研发提供理论参考。

Liver diseases have become a global health challenge due to their complex pathophysiology and limited clinical treatment strategies. Scutellaria baicalensis, a traditional Chinese medicine, possesses therapeutic effects including clearing heat and drying dampness, purging fire, detoxifying, and arresting bleeding to stabilize pregnancy. Modern pharmacological studies reveal its diverse pharmacological activities, such as antibacterial, antiviral, anti-inflammatory, antipyretic, hepatoprotective, and cholagogue effects. Increasing evidence indicates that S. baicalensis, its active components, and compound preparations demonstrate significant therapeutic efficacy in liver diseases such as viral hepatitis, non-alcoholic fatty liver disease, liver fibrosis, and hepatocellular carcinoma. This paper systematically searched databases including CNKI and PubMed using keywords “Scutellaria baicalensis”, “active components” “liver diseases”, and “mechanism of action” to review relevant studies on S. baicalensis, its active components, and compound preparations in liver diseases. The aim is to summarize the key mechanisms by which the primary active components and compound preparations of S. baicalensis regulate liver diseases including anti-inflammatory and antioxidant effects, regulation of autophagy and apoptosis, inhibition of hepatic stellate cell activation, and modulation of gut microbiota. This review aims to provide scientific evidence for elucidating its pharmacological actions and offer theoretical references for clinical treatment and new drug development in liver diseases.
